** The home security market in and around Marble, NC, is characteristic of a rural mountain community. There is a mix of a few dedicated local/regional providers and larger companies that service the area from regional hubs. Competition is moderate but personalized; local companies like Mountain Security & Alarms compete effectively through strong community ties and responsive service. The average quality is high, as providers must be versatile to serve both standard residential needs and larger, more remote properties common in the region. Typical pricing for a professionally installed system starts around $500-$1,500 for equipment and installation, with 24/7 professional monitoring services ranging from $35 to $65 per month. Customers highly value reliability due to potential longer emergency response times, making the quality of the monitoring service and cellular backup a critical factor. There is a growing trend towards integrating security cameras and smart home automation, which all top providers in the area now support.

In the Marble and greater Cherokee County area, a basic professionally installed system typically starts between $200-$600 for equipment and installation, with monthly monitoring fees ranging from $30 to $60. Local factors like the rural terrain and longer drive times for technicians can sometimes slightly increase installation quotes compared to urban areas. Additionally, homes with larger properties may require more extensive equipment, impacting the overall cost.
Marble's climate, with its cold winters, potential for heavy rain, and occasional severe thunderstorms, necessitates choosing equipment rated for outdoor use and wide temperature ranges. It's crucial to ensure cameras and sensors are properly sealed against moisture and that your system has a reliable backup power source (like a cellular radio and battery) to maintain protection during frequent mountain power outages. Regular seasonal checks of camera lenses for fogging or spider webs are also recommended.
Generally, no permit is required to install a residential security system in Marble. However, if your system includes monitored fire/smoke alarms, you must register the alarm with the Cherokee County Central Communications Center, as false alarm fines can apply after multiple occurrences. It's also wise to check with your homeowner's insurance provider, as many offer discounts for monitored systems, which is a valuable local financial consideration.
Prioritize providers with proven, reliable cellular monitoring, as landlines can be less dependable in rural Marble. Look for companies with local technicians who understand the terrain and can provide prompt service. It's also beneficial to choose a provider experienced with securing larger, wooded properties common in the area, offering solutions like long-range motion-activated cameras for driveways and outbuildings.
While crime rates are lower, a security system serves critical functions beyond crime deterrence, especially in a rural mountain community. The primary benefits for Marble homeowners often include immediate emergency dispatch for medical alerts, fire and carbon monoxide detection, and remote property monitoring while you're away during seasonal fluctuations (like checking for frozen pipes in winter or wildlife activity). It provides essential peace of mind for isolated properties.
